Diesel fuel additives are specially formulated chemicals added to diesel fuel to improve its quality and performance. These additives help in reducing engine wear, preventing fuel system corrosion, and optimizing combustion efficiency. Bottled fuel additives are pre-mixed formulations that are easily added to the fuel tank of diesel vehicles or machines.
There are various types of fuel additives available in the market, including cetane improvers, lubricity enhancers, and fuel system cleaners. Each type of additive serves a specific purpose, such as enhancing the ignition quality of the fuel, reducing the buildup of deposits in the engine, or improving fuel efficiency. With the growing focus on sustainability and reducing carbon emissions, fuel additives that help in reducing harmful emissions are gaining popularity.
The diesel bottled fuel additive market has seen rapid growth due to several factors:
Rising Demand for Diesel Engines: Diesel-powered vehicles, including trucks, buses, and construction equipment, remain a significant part of the global transportation and industrial sectors. This increasing demand for diesel engines directly drives the need for fuel additives.
Environmental Regulations: Stricter emission norms and environmental regulations are pushing diesel vehicle owners to adopt additives that help reduce pollutants and ensure compliance with emission standards.
Improved Fuel Efficiency: With fuel prices constantly fluctuating, fuel additives that enhance fuel efficiency are in high demand. Diesel additives can improve fuel combustion, leading to better mileage and lower fuel consumption.

Despite the growth of the market, there are several challenges that need to be addressed:
Price Sensitivity: The cost of fuel additives can be a significant concern for consumers, particularly in price-sensitive regions.
Consumer Awareness: A lack of awareness about the benefits of diesel additives may limit market growth. Many diesel engine owners are unaware of the advantages that these additives can bring.
Regulatory Challenges: As emission standards tighten, manufacturers must ensure that their fuel additives comply with changing regulations, which can be a complex and costly process.
